Project Description: |
Construct new stormwater conveyance and pumping system in the south sector of the County and City areas to drawdown stormwater into a planned stormwater treatment area South Florida Water Management District will construct. Add appropriate conveyance structures and pump station(s). |

Measurable Outcome Anticipated: |
Prevention of blockage from flooding to major cross-state evacuation routes. Stormwater protection to residents and visitors in the Okeechobee area. Additional water supply for SFWMD STA. Reduction of nutrients when supply is conveyed to SFWMD STA. Quantified date not yet available from SFWMD. |
